Volunteer Work: Showcase your commitment to social causes and community involvement by including volunteer work on your resume. This not only demonstrates your dedication but also highlights your ability to work well with others and make a positive impact beyond the workplace.
Professional Memberships: Highlighting your involvement in professional organizations relevant to your industry can demonstrate your commitment to staying informed and connected within your field. This indicates a proactive approach to professional development.
Language Proficiency: If you are fluent in multiple languages, it's a valuable asset that can make your resume stand out. Multilingual abilities showcase cultural awareness and can be a significant advantage in today's globalized job market.
Sports and Fitness: Interests in sports and fitness not only convey a healthy lifestyle but also suggest qualities such as discipline, teamwork, and a competitive spirit – all of which are highly desirable in various professional settings.
Creative Hobbies: Highlighting creative hobbies, such as painting, writing, or photography, can showcase a unique perspective and creativity that can be applied to problem-solving and innovation in the workplace.
Technology and Coding: In today's tech-driven world, showcasing an interest in technology or coding can signal adaptability and a willingness to embrace innovation. This is especially valuable in industries that are heavily reliant on technological advancements.
Public Speaking: If you have a passion for public speaking or are involved in activities like Toastmasters, include it on your resume. This demonstrates strong communication skills, confidence, and the ability to articulate ideas effectively.
Remember, the key is to tailor your interests to align with the job you're applying for, emphasizing qualities that will resonate with potential employers.
